From 089e8e9b7a11ca0cefb6982de41517ac15160fc9 Mon Sep 17 00:00:00 2001 From: ozrendev Date: Thu, 6 Nov 2025 16:49:29 +0100 Subject: [PATCH 1/2] round playback value --- .../components/ft-shaka-video-player/ft-shaka-video-player.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/renderer/components/ft-shaka-video-player/ft-shaka-video-player.js b/src/renderer/components/ft-shaka-video-player/ft-shaka-video-player.js index 35587e181748c..5e59bbc4b373b 100644 --- a/src/renderer/components/ft-shaka-video-player/ft-shaka-video-player.js +++ b/src/renderer/components/ft-shaka-video-player/ft-shaka-video-player.js @@ -1966,7 +1966,7 @@ export default defineComponent({ const popUpLayout = seconds > 0 ? { icon: 'arrow-right', invertContentOrder: true } : { icon: 'arrow-left', invertContentOrder: false } - const formattedSeconds = Math.abs(seconds) + const formattedSeconds = Math.abs(seconds).toFixed(2) showValueChange(`${formattedSeconds}s`, popUpLayout.icon, popUpLayout.invertContentOrder) } From 020c7aa03ae24df173d7269fd6fc1c711c5972b5 Mon Sep 17 00:00:00 2001 From: efb4f5ff-1298-471a-8973-3d47447115dc <73130443+efb4f5ff-1298-471a-8973-3d47447115dc@users.noreply.github.com> Date: Fri, 7 Nov 2025 06:16:40 +0100 Subject: [PATCH 2/2] Update src/renderer/components/ft-shaka-video-player/ft-shaka-video-player.js Co-authored-by: PikachuEXE --- .../components/ft-shaka-video-player/ft-shaka-video-player.js |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/renderer/components/ft-shaka-video-player/ft-shaka-video-player.js b/src/renderer/components/ft-shaka-video-player/ft-shaka-video-player.js index 5e59bbc4b373b..e4b52d37b4097 100644 --- a/src/renderer/components/ft-shaka-video-player/ft-shaka-video-player.js +++ b/src/renderer/components/ft-shaka-video-player/ft-shaka-video-player.js @@ -1966,7 +1966,8 @@ export default defineComponent({ const popUpLayout = seconds > 0 ? { icon: 'arrow-right', invertContentOrder: true } : { icon: 'arrow-left', invertContentOrder: false } - const formattedSeconds = Math.abs(seconds).toFixed(2) + // `+value` converts string back to float + const formattedSeconds = +Math.abs(seconds).toFixed(2) showValueChange(`${formattedSeconds}s`, popUpLayout.icon, popUpLayout.invertContentOrder) }